Policing Diversity: Lessons From Lambeth, A. Benjamin Spencer, Michael Hough
Policing Diversity: Lessons From Lambeth, A. Benjamin Spencer, Michael Hough
Faculty Publications
This report describes a local initiative, Policing Diversity in Lambeth (PDL), which was developed to address the challenges of policing a highly ethnically diverse population.
The report is timely. The report of the Macpherson Inquiry into the death of Stephen Lawrence has substantially redrawn the policy landscape in relation to policing and race issues. The Home Secretary’s priorities for policing in 2000-1 emphasise the need for improved community relations. The follow-up report by Her Majesty’s Inspectorate of Constabulary, ‘Winning the Race Revisited’, further stressed the need for urgent action.
